Transaction

9bd141432fdcc61c4037504e5f0dc0d94da5ab2ec9be119e548293cae351d4d0

Summary

In Block746454
TimeTue, 18 Jun 2024 16:57:00 UTC
Total Input698.36840515 Nebula
Total Output719.36840515 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
219727 Confirmations719.36840515 Nebula
Raw Transaction